Gestational diabetes mellitus (GDM) poses significant challenges for healthcare professionals, with implications for both maternal and fetal health. The need for effective management strategies is paramount to optimize outcomes and mitigate risks associated with GDM.
Early detection and diagnosis of GDM are crucial. Universal screening, preferably between 24-28 weeks gestation, using oral glucose tolerance tests, can enable early intervention. Risk-based screening, considering factors like age, BMI, and family history, can further enhance detection rates.
MNT forms the cornerstone of GDM management. A dietitian-led individualized meal plan, focusing on a balanced intake of complex carbohydrates, fiber, and lean proteins, can effectively control blood glucose levels. Regular monitoring of dietary intake and glycemic response is essential.
Regular physical activity complements MNT in managing GDM. Moderate-intensity exercises, such as brisk walking or swimming, for at least 150 minutes per week, can improve insulin sensitivity and glycemic control. Exercise plans should be individualized, considering the patient's pre-pregnancy activity levels and current health status.
When lifestyle modifications fail to achieve glycemic targets, pharmacological intervention becomes necessary. Insulin therapy remains the gold standard. However, recent studies indicate that oral hypoglycemic agents like metformin and glyburide can be safe and effective alternatives.
Postpartum follow-up is critical as GDM increases the risk of type 2 diabetes later in life. Regular glucose testing, lifestyle modifications, and possibly pharmacological interventions are key to prevent or delay the onset of type 2 diabetes.
Optimizing outcomes in GDM requires a comprehensive, multidisciplinary approach involving early detection, lifestyle modifications, pharmacological interventions, and diligent postpartum follow-up.
